Solution for 0.2p-4=0.67p equation:


Simplifying
0.2p + -4 = 0.67p

Reorder the terms:
-4 + 0.2p = 0.67p

Solving
-4 + 0.2p = 0.67p

Solving for variable 'p'.

Move all terms containing p to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-0.67p' to each side of the equation.
-4 + 0.2p + -0.67p = 0.67p + -0.67p

Combine like terms: 0.2p + -0.67p = -0.47p
-4 + -0.47p = 0.67p + -0.67p

Combine like terms: 0.67p + -0.67p = 0.00
-4 + -0.47p = 0.00

Add '4' to each side of the equation.
-4 + 4 + -0.47p = 0.00 + 4

Combine like terms: -4 + 4 = 0
0 + -0.47p = 0.00 + 4
-0.47p = 0.00 + 4

Combine like terms: 0.00 + 4 = 4
-0.47p = 4

Divide each side by '-0.47'.
p = -8.510638298

Simplifying
p = -8.510638298
